The democratization of research, spurred by the Open Science movement, is rapidly transforming the scholarly publishing landscape. Open Science promotes unhindered access to research findings and articles for the public, and collaborative research, supported by digital tools. It fosters greater transparency in research, creating an environment conducive to the sharing of knowledge and trust through open access.

The basic tenets of Open Science are open data, open materials, open analysis, pre-registration, and open access. By increasing transparency, Open Science increases the replicability of research, bringing a systemic change to how scientific research is conducted. According to the OECD, Open Science:

  1. Fosters more accurate verification of research results.
  2. Reduces duplication in “collecting, creating, transferring, and re-using scientific material.”
  3. Enhances productivity, especially during times of tight budgets.
  4. Leads to better innovation potential and improved consumer choice.
  5. Promotes trust in science.

Challenges to Meeting Open Science and Open Access  Requirements for Journal Publishers

While Open Science has brought multiple benefits, it has also thrown up challenges for scholarly publishers, such as increased costs and time, reduced flexibility, incompatibility with existing incentive structure, the emergence of predatory journals, high article processing fees, open access charges, and lack of funding support.

Given that the majority of authors choose a journal based on its reputation, open-access journals are at a disadvantage due to the misconception that such journals are of lower quality. However, it is important to remember that most open-access journals ensure peer reviews and uphold stringent quality standards for all their published works.

The history of Medicina

When we took over Medicina in 2018, the owner of the journal, the Lithuanian University of Health Sciences, had many concerns about transitioning to gold open access. The journal had a long history, as it was launched in 1920 and went through different changes due to the political and historical events that affected Lithuania during and after World War II. 

The journal was already open access in 2001, embracing the philosophy of making the latest research freely available to everyone without subscription or other paywalled restrictions. In 2014, Medicina was transferred to Elsevier and published in a diamond open access model, supported by an EU grant. 

In September 2017, we got in contact with the Editor-in-Chief of Medicina, Prof. Edgaras Stankevičius, for the first time. The EU grant was going to end soon, and the university was interested in knowing more about sustainable alternatives to continue publishing the journal. The introduction of APCs was a concern for the institution, as its members worried that they would deter authors from submitting to the journal.

Transitioning to gold open access

A series of meetings took place in the following weeks. In them, we explained how APCs not only allow publishers to cover the editorial and publication costs but also to reinvest in the journal and launch services and initiatives to support researchers. As MDPI does not work with external vendors, we are able to closely control the quality, timing and costs of publication, being able to charge APCs that are highly competitive on the market. 

Of course, we offer a range of discounts and memberships to financially support the authors. For example, the Institutional Open Access Program (IOAP) that counts more than 800 affiliated institutes offers discounts on APCs for associated researchers, and discount vouchers are provided to reviewers that submit comprehensive and timely review reports. Members of societies affiliated with the journal also benefit from discounts. 

We were confident that Medicina would develop nicely, strongly believing in its potential after transitioning to gold open access. 

In 2018, the contract was signed, a Managing Editor was appointed and a dedicated editorial team was organized to support the journal in all the day-to-day operations. The transition was smooth, and the first issue of Medicina was published that same year by MDPI.  

Gold open access leads to growth 

The newly established Medicina editorial team visited the Lithuanian University of Health Sciences in Kaunas, and the Editor-in-Chief and other representatives on the journal travelled to our headquarters in Basel, Switzerland. These personal interactions helped to develop trust in the relationship between the editorial board and MDPI, and to build the foundations for a long-term collaboration. 

For the first year and a half, to support the journal in its transition period, we heavily invested in the journal so it could completely waive the APCs. This is always a delicate moment, requiring a lot of collaboration and flexibility not only with the institute and the editorial board of the journal but also with the previous publisher. The authors, readers and other stakeholders of the journal also needed to be informed and supported throughout the process.  

In agreement with the university, in 2019, we introduced an APC of 1500 CHF to publish in the journal. The number of publications increased by more than 600% that year, and the good quality of articles published in Medicina led to a substantial increase in its impact factor. 

Medicina in 2023

Currently, the journal features 25 sections, of which many were established in 2020. The journal is still led by Prof. Stankevičius and is supported by an editorial board of more than 400 experts in all the different areas of medicine. The journal’s visibility on the MDPI website, which received more than 90 million monthly views in 2022, drew a lot of attention to it, attracting more readers and, consequently, more citations. 

To align with the expansion of journal services, market conditions, inflation costs and a significant increase in the number of submissions and rejected papers, the APCs increased to 1800 CHF in January 2022, making the journal a good source of income for the university. In 2022, we published 1,840 citable items and received more than 10,000 citations. The journal keeps growing in an exponential and healthy way thanks to it transitioning to gold open access and publishing high-quality work.

In an era of rapidly evolving technology and accelerating scientific progress, the promise of a democratized, inclusive, and borderless knowledge universe is becoming tangible, fuelled by two powerful movements - Open Science and Open Access.

At its core, Open Science is the practice of making scientific research transparent and accessible to everyone, including open methodologies and open-source software to open data and public access to published work. Open Access is a key part of Open Science. It is a publishing model that enables scholarly publications to be made freely accessible, eliminating the barrier of paywalls.

These concepts emerged from the desire to democratize science and foster a global research community unbounded by financial and institutional barriers. Since the inception of the Budapest Open Access Initiative in 2002, the ultimate vision is one of a scientific ecosystem where knowledge isn't a privilege, but a communal asset. This dynamic promises to stimulate interdisciplinary innovation, enhance public comprehension, and light the way towards a more equitable future for global research.

In this blog post we’ll summarize the opportunities and tensions behind these initiatives, and show how Highwire supports them by supporting relevant publishing models on our platform.

Open Data: Unveiling the Power of Shared Knowledge

Open Data stands for the idea that data collected during research should be freely accessible, enabling anyone to explore, use, and benefit from it.

Unveiling the wealth of knowledge embedded in scientific data, not only enables researchers to build upon each other's work but also allows for innovative analyses and interpretations beyond the scope of the original study. The story of the Human Genome Project stands as a testament to the transformative power of Open Data. The initiative – started by our long-term partners at Cold Spring Harbor Laboratory – made genome sequences publicly available, igniting a surge of advancements in genomics, personalized medicine, and biotechnology.

However, the road to Open Data is not without hurdles. Researchers often grapple with data privacy issues, particularly in sensitive fields like healthcare. The lack of standardized formats and metadata can also lead to disorganized and hard-to-use data sets. Costs associated with maintaining accessible, reliable data also pose a significant challenge leading to innovative solutions such as Dryad, who we partner with to make data discoverable, freely reusable, and citable.

Open Access Books: Pioneering Free Access to Scholarly Literature

Beyond journal articles, the drive towards freely accessible scholarly literature has led to an upswing in Open Access Books. This shift acknowledges that academic knowledge can be encapsulated in many different forms of content, which was the driving force behind Highwire Hosting being the first platform to support any content type as a first class citizen. Books, for example, can be as dynamic and evolving as research papers and equally deserving of broad dissemination.

For authors, this publishing model presents a new avenue to share their work with a global audience, magnifying their reach and potential impact. Readers, especially those from resource-constrained regions, benefit from unrestricted access to vital scholarly works. For publishers, the journey toward Open Access Books is a delicate balance between championing knowledge dissemination and ensuring financial viability. Innovative models, like Knowledge Unlatched's crowd-funding approach, show promise in navigating these complexities.

Professional Societies & Open Access: Navigating the Currents

Professional societies play a crucial role in the scientific ecosystem, not just as gatekeepers of quality but also as proponents of community-specific issues, such as advocating for research in under-explored areas and policy changes based on scientific evidence.

However, their smaller scale, as compared to commercial publishers, presents unique challenges, particularly in the context of transitioning to Open Access. Challenges include:

  • Financial Stability: Transitioning to Open Access implies moving away from a subscription-based revenue model which means devising financially sustainable Open Access models that can support their operations.
  • Brand Value and Quality: Societies are often recognized for their quality publications. There may be apprehensions that moving to an Open Access model could dilute this perception of quality.
  • Infrastructure and Expertise: Societies may lack the infrastructure for handling the Open Access publication process, from article processing charge (APC) management to copyright handling.
  • Equity and Inclusivity: APCs can exclude authors with limited funding. Therefore, Societies must consider innovative models that ensure researchers from all backgrounds can participate.

As an independent organization, HighWire allows smaller societies to maintain independence from commercial publishers, while still providing industry-leading publishing tools.

Equitable Open Access Models: The Path to Inclusive Science 

As the move toward open access accelerates, the conversation is shifting from "why" to "how." Many traditional models of Open Access present limitations in fostering inclusivity, especially among underrepresented or underfunded researchers. This gives rise to a critical question: How can we ensure equitable access not just for readers but also for authors? 

There are several exciting models emerging in response to this need. 

  • "Read-and-Publish" agreements, where institutions pay a single, combined fee covering both the cost of reading and publishing for their researchers.
  • "Subscribe to Open" model turns the traditional subscription model on its head; instead of subscribing to read, libraries subscribe to make a journal open for everyone.
  • "Fee Waivers" offer reductions or waivers of APCs for authors from low-income countries and early-career researchers.

What is the project/product that you submitted for the Awards?

Original Études for the Developing Conductor is a peer-reviewed, freely-available, and Creative Commons-licensed collection of 25 original compositions designed to enhance contemporary conducting pedagogy by amplifying the voices of composers from historically excluded groups. This resource presents original études beyond what are typically available from the Public Domain. While a print-on-demand option is available, we have worked to create a resource that is freely available and easy to navigate electronically. QR codes and hyperlinks are provided throughout the text to help digital users move around quickly and easily. It is available in multiple formats including digital PDF, print (scores only), and audio. Downloadable PDF versions are available for scores only (160+ pages) and for scores plus parts (700+ pages). 

The collection is currently the only known conducting-specific resource that contains music by a diverse group of living composers, is open-access, and is easily navigable in digital and print formats. Original Études for the Developing Conductor was published on April 27, 2023. 

Tell us a little about how it works and the team behind it

This collection of 25 original musical scores and parts is designed for use as a supplement for conducting education at advanced undergraduate and graduate levels. Études range from thirty seconds to four minutes in length and are original compositions designed to create a unified musical narrative. Each étude has an introductory page that includes a link to a MIDI realization (MP4) of the étude, a list of the parameters of the commission, additional pedagogical opportunities identified by the editors, information about the étude and composer, and a link to the composer’s website. Études were commissioned from a group of 65 invited composers from historically excluded groups, and composed by 25 living composers according to a set of musical characteristics and pedagogical opportunities designated by the editors.

Our hope is that this book will better prepare conducting students for the musical world they are entering while also reinforcing the existing pedagogical goals of conducting teachers across the United States and beyond. Despite the fact that conducting pedagogy is continually evolving, the examples students encounter in conducting classes tend to remain the same. By meeting the needs of modern students while also celebrating the voices of a diverse cross-section of contemporary composers, we hope this book offers a significant contribution to conducting pedagogy that supports the classroom goals of any conducting teacher regardless of pedagogical approach. As a zero-cost, openly licensed supplemental text featuring the music of many composers who have been historically excluded, we hope this book addresses current pedagogical issues of equity, diversity, inclusion, and access in a meaningful way. We also hope that the way music is published and navigated within a digital environment will change as a result of this publication.

Extensive efforts have been undertaken to ensure the usability of this resource for classroom use and beyond: 

  • We conducted usability testing with students based on classroom scenarios;
  • The text is freely available in multiple digital formats including high and low-resolution PDFs of scores and parts, and of scores only;
  • An introductory table displays musical characteristics and commissioned elements for each étude;
  • Layout, design, and navigation of the text were specifically designed for ease of digital download and navigation including in-document links which enable navigation within the overall book through a linked table of contents, navigation to and within individual scores, parts, and back to the score from each part; 
  • PDFs may be self-printed and are also available to order as a “scores only” spiral-bound softcover print-on-demand version;
  • Links and QR codes direct digital and print users to MIDI realizations (MP4s) available via a YouTube playlist, or to the book’s main landing page;
  • In the digital “scores and parts” version, links at the bottom of each cover page enable the reader to “jump to” transposed parts for their instrument, return to the linked table of contents, or visit the main landing page of the resource;
  • To enable accessibility for musicians who are blind or have low vision, the text, images, and links in the PDF versions of this text are tagged structurally and include alternative text, which allows for machine readability;
  • The book was professionally engraved, copyedited, and typeset. MIDI realizations (MP4) were created and are freely available via YouTube;

The twenty-five composers who accepted commissions for this work and whose names are prominently featured on the book’s cover made this possible.They include: Spencer Arias, David Biendenbender, Susan Botti, Matthew Browne, Trevor Bumgarner, Yi Chen, Brent Michael Davids, Gala Flagello, Max Grafe, Ivette Rodriguez Herryman, Jennifer Jolley, Molly Joyce, Alexis Lamb, Lynnsey Lambrecht,Shuying Li, Ricardo Lorenz, Sally Lamb McCune, Hillary Purrington, Will Rowe, Christopher Sherwood-Gabrielson, Elena Spect, Hilary Tann, and Roger Zare. 

The project leadership team includes four people: two music subject matter experts, Dr. Jonathan Caldwell of the University of North Carolina at Greensboro and Dr. Derek Shapiro at Virginia Tech who served as lead editors for the project, and two members of the Open Education Initiative of the University Libraries at Virginia Tech, Anita Walz, Managing Editor, and Kindred Grey, OER and Graphic Design Specialist, who were deeply involved in project design, peer review, development, and production. Matt Browne and Artem Bank contributed music engraving and MIDI realizations to the project. 


In what ways do you think it demonstrates innovation?

Original Études for the Developing Conductor demonstrates impact and innovation in multiple ways. 

  • Open-access music textbook publishing: No-cost online availability under a Creative Commons license is a significant benefit for students who more than ever struggle to afford textbooks and course materials, and as required course for music degrees, conducting is a high-need area for freely-available and openly-licensed course materials. 
  • Centering students as part of project design: The project centers student needs and real-world classroom use by involving students and student-centric planning throughout the project planning process. This has resulted in innovative ways to ensure access, accessibility, relevant design, engagement, and in-document navigation, notably the use of QR codes and links to enable speedy navigation between scores, parts, and the Table of Contents, using a spiral-binding for the print version, and the inclusion of more representative composers than currently available textbooks.
  • Centering diverse composers and contemporary music: Prior to initiating this project, our review of more than 250 excerpts in five prominent conducting textbooks revealed inclusion of only one woman composer and one person of color. Our text features composers from historically underrepresented groups, provides a short biographical statement, photo, link to the composer’s website, and the composer’s description of their etude. By centering a diversity of composers and contemporary music this work builds awareness of more diverse, living composers, current musical styles, and enhances engagement especially of students from historically marginalized groups.
  • Prioritizing in-document navigation: Our student reviewers are so excited about the navigation in the book: “I’ve never seen this before. I wish that everyone would do this.” In class students are frequently asked to locate a score within a collection, conduct the score, play their instrument’s part and return to the score. In an analog environment this means page-turns in a 700+ page volume. In a digital environment, this necessitates scrolling or navigating to multiple files on one or more devices. Our publication leverages a linked Table of Contents to quickly navigate to any score, links from scores to each part, links from each part back to the score or Table of Contents, plus links and QR codes for print and digital users to navigate to an MP4 for each piece or to return to the full digital text. We are excited about the effectiveness of this approach for in-class use of this work and what it means for student learning. We also hope that music publishers will catch on and imitate this relevant and innovative approach.
  • Proof of concept for open-access music textbook publishing. Publishing open access necessitates exploration of different financial models and creates opportunities for change and for entry of new players into the publishing space. We acknowledge the value of composers’ work by paying them in advance rather than relying on royalties and allowing retention of author rights while obtaining consent to release their work under a non-exclusive CC BY NC SA license. We reverted to a “patron pays” funding model and leverage funding carefully by maintaining a lean publishing operation. This project demonstrates that significant, real-world impacts are possible even for a small, focused team.

There are 2 types of seminars in the Cassyni Journal Seminar Series, Keynote seminars and Author-led seminars. 

Keynote seminars are live online events presented by authors hand-picked by the journal editors for their outstanding research. The seminars are promoted to the journal’s audience, who can attend the event and subscribe to the series, enabling the publisher to build a community around a topic, discipline or journal. Cassyni Keynote Seminars capture the magic of an in-person seminar, with the added bonus of being able to include a more diverse and geographically dispersed audience. The ‘watch later’ functionality allows researchers in different timezones or those unable to attend live to view the recording and take part in the Q&A asynchronously. All seminar recordings are preserved in a custom branded journal seminar series page on Cassyni. 


 
Author-led Seminars are designed to be scalable and require minimal input from journal teams. Selected authors are invited to give a Cassyni seminar as part of the manuscript acceptance process through a light-touch integration with editorial management systems. Authors simply click on the Cassyni link which walks them through the self-serve seminar publishing workflow. Online seminars based on a researcher’s latest publications are a proven route to increased reach and accelerated impact, helping them disseminate their findings to new audiences and boosting research integrity. 

In what ways do you think it demonstrates innovation?

Research seminar series form the centres of communities in which academics across disciplines share and discuss the latest research. However, without dedicated workflow tools and supporting infrastructure journal publishers have not been able to engage researchers participating in these communities in a systematic and scalable way. Increasingly, researchers are seeking out online events and videos as compelling complements to published articles when consuming research. For many researchers a 30 minute seminar can be a more engaging entry point to a new topic than a 30 page manuscript. 

Seminar recordings are automatically enhanced using Cassyni’s proprietary AI technology to produce high quality transcripts, extract slides and detect and resolve references to other scholarly works contained in the talk. The enhanced recording which includes automatic hyperlinks to journal content embedded in the video and is then published with a DOI ensuring it is part of the scholarly record. What is the project/product that you submitted for the Awards?

As a design partner, Medwave collaborated with Kriyadocs to establish a fully bilingual peer review and production platform capable of handling submissions in both Spanish and English. The platform includes comprehensive Spanish copyediting and English translation stages to ensure consistency throughout the publication process.

This submission is based on the Learned Publishing article titled "A technology-based, financially sustainable, quality improvement intervention in a medical journal for bilingualism from submission to publication" by Dr. Vivienne C. Bachelet and Dr. Máximo Rousseau Portalis (Bachelet & Rousseau-Portalis, 2023*).

Tell us a little about how it works and the team behind it

Kriyadocs' online submission system manages peer review in the journal's source language and seamlessly transitions to the copyediting, typesetting, and proof-checking module. A modification was programmed by the Kriyadocs team to handle production processes for both the source language and its translated version.

Salient features of the workflow that enable and enhance the fully bilingual journal publication include:

  • An online submission system that is capable of handling peer review in the journal’s source language.
  • A smooth transition from the peer review process to production—including copyediting, typesetting, and proof checking, with an XML-first approach.
  • The use of AI-based tools, such as DeepL for language translation and Grammarly for content editing, by Medwave editors to produce error-free translations with speed, efficiency, and lower costs.
  • Fully automated PDF and JATS XML files for publication, as well as deposits to third-party preservation and archiving platforms.
  • Automated recycling of non-translatable sections reduces inconsistencies between original and translated versions of articles.
  • Simultaneous publication of both Spanish and English versions of the journal.

The ACTIVE platform, available as an open source software, generates the fully bilingual website for the journal. The website has been set up such that it transitions seamlessly between the Spanish and English interfaces.

After the implementation of this intervention, the journal was able to offer full bilingualism for manuscripts submitted in Spanish and ensure the simultaneous publication of Spanish and English articles with no delays between versions.

In what ways do you think it demonstrates innovation?

A bilingual journal enables the dissemination of research to a larger audience while preserving the local language and locally-generated knowledge, as Dr. Bachelet presented at the Ninth International Congress on Peer Review and Scientific Publication. However, this can be a cost- and resource-intensive endeavor.




Dr. Vivienne C. Bachelet and Ravi Venkataramani at 9th Peer Review Congress


This collaboration is significant and innovative because it established a fully bilingual peer review and production platform capable of handling submissions in both Spanish and English. This solution not only empowers authors to submit their articles in their native language but also broadens the pool of potential reviewers by enabling peer review to be conducted in the same language. The platform streamlines the publication process and enables the simultaneous publication of original and translated articles with no compromise in quality.

This solution offers numerous advantages to enhance Medwave’s publication process.

  • It reduces inconsistencies between the original and translated versions of articles and eases the burden on human translators by automatically recycling non-translatable sections such as metadata, abstracts, keywords, and references.
  • It has also led to increased efficiencies in the publication process, resulting in shorter review rounds, fewer human errors, and full automation of PDF typesetting and XML JATS files for publication, database deposits, and third-party preservation archiving. 
  • In 2019, there was a gap of 31 days between the publication of the original Spanish article and its translated version. The bilingual workflow has eliminated the gap and enabled the simultaneous publication of both versions of the article
